The Importance of Personal Brand Growth in Wahama Football and E-sports
Personal brand growth is becoming increasingly important in niche communities like Wahama Football and E-sports. As these fields grow in popularity, individuals who cultivate a recognizable and authentic personal brand can stand out and create more opportunities for themselves. Whether you are a player, coach, content creator, or influencer, your personal brand helps define how others perceive you and can influence your career trajectory.
In Wahama Football and E-sports, visibility is key. With many talented individuals competing for attention, having a strong personal brand can help you connect with fans, sponsors, and collaborators. It also allows you to communicate your unique skills, values, and personality in a way that resonates with your audience. This visibility can lead to invitations to tournaments, partnerships, or even roles within teams and organizations.
Building a personal brand in these communities involves more than just showcasing your skills. It requires consistency, authenticity, and engagement with your audience. By focusing on personal brand growth, you develop a reputation that extends beyond your immediate performance, opening doors to long-term success and influence.

Effective Personal Branding Strategies for Wahama Football and E-sports
Building a personal brand in Wahama Football and E-sports requires a focused approach that highlights your unique skills and personality. Start by creating consistent and high-quality content that showcases your gameplay, training routines, or insights into the sport and gaming scene. This content can take many forms, such as videos, live streams, tutorials, or blog posts, and should be tailored to the interests of your target audience.
Engaging with the community is equally important. Participate actively in forums, social media groups, and live events where Wahama Football and E-sports enthusiasts gather. Responding to comments, joining discussions, and sharing useful information helps you build trust and establish yourself as a relatable figure within these niches. Community engagement also opens doors to networking opportunities and collaborations.
Collaborating with influencers who already have a foothold in Wahama Football or E-sports can accelerate your personal brand growth. Partnering on content, co-hosting streams, or participating in tournaments together can introduce you to a wider audience and add credibility to your profile. Choose collaborators whose values and style align with yours to maintain authenticity.
Selecting the right platforms is crucial for reaching your audience effectively. Wahama Football fans might prefer platforms like Instagram and YouTube for highlights and tutorials, while E-sports followers often engage more on Twitch and Discord. Understanding where your audience spends their time allows you to focus your efforts and resources efficiently.

Community Engagement and Its Role in Enhancing Brand Visibility
Active participation in the Wahama Football and E-sports communities plays a crucial role in growing your personal brand. By consistently engaging with fans, players, and other stakeholders, you build trust and loyalty that can significantly increase your brand's visibility. Being present in discussions, sharing insights, and supporting community events helps establish you as a recognizable and reliable figure within these circles.
Engagement goes beyond just posting content—it involves meaningful interactions such as responding to comments, joining live streams, and collaborating with other community members. These activities not only expand your reach but also create authentic connections that encourage others to follow and promote your brand organically.

Maintaining Authenticity and Long-Term Growth in Personal Branding
Sustaining authenticity is essential for long-term personal brand growth, especially in dynamic fields like Wahama Football and E-sports. Levi Russell emphasizes that being genuine in your messaging and interactions builds trust with your audience. Avoid trying to fit a mold or exaggerate your achievements; instead, share your true experiences and values consistently.
Transparency plays a key role in maintaining meaningful connections. Whether discussing challenges or successes, openness encourages your followers to relate to you on a personal level. This approach fosters loyalty and encourages ongoing engagement, which is vital for lasting brand growth.
Consistent engagement is another pillar of enduring personal branding. Regularly interacting with your audience through updates, responses, and shared content keeps your community active and invested in your journey. This steady presence helps reinforce your brand identity over time.
